Noctua Launches NA-FG1 Series Fan Grille

Noctua announced the launch of the NA-FG1 series of fan grills, covering its 40mm, 50mm, 60mm, 70mm, 80mm, 92mm, 120mm, 140mm, and 200mm fans. Supplied kits include screw and toolless mounting systems. Noctua said that the product helps reduce turbulence, thereby improving airflow performance and reducing noise levels. It is a high-quality fan grill that satisfies acoustic optimization and is easy to install.

“Fan grills may seem like a trivial accessory, but many available solutions can seriously hamper your fans’ acoustics and performance, so we decided to offer our own selection of grills”, explains Roland Mossig (Noctua CEO). “Our NA-FG1 use a proven, highly efficient design and top it off with a convenient tool-free mounting system that introduces an extra offset and can thereby help to improve both airflow and noise levels.”

The included tool-less mounting system not only makes installation easier for the user but also introduces an additional 5mm offset in order to achieve even lower influx turbulence, further improving running smoothness, and better airflow performance. In Noctua’s tests, the additional offset reduced the grille’s average impact on airflow performance from 3% to 2%, and its average impact on noise levels from 1.2 dB(A) to 0.6 dB(A).

The starting price of the Noctua NA-FG1 series fan grills starts at $12.90, and the price varies with different sizes and kits, up to $29.90
